Paola Skate Park Set to Open After Long-Awaited Delay
Paola Skate Park to Open Soon, Despite Being Completed a Year-and-a-Half Ago
Hot Malta readers, get ready to roll! After an excruciating wait, the Paola skate park is set to open its doors soon. This much-anticipated facility has been ready for action since mid-2021, but due to a series of bureaucratic hurdles and logistical issues, it has remained closed. Now, finally, the wheels are in motion, and local skateboarding enthusiasts are gearing up for some serious shredding.
Located in the heart of Paola, this skate park is more than just a concrete playground for skateboarders; it’s a cultural hub that promises to bring together a diverse community of thrill-seekers, young and old. The park features an array of ramps, bowls, and rails designed to cater to all skill levels, making it accessible to both beginners and seasoned pros.
